The "Golden Hours" of care refers to the unique care of very low birth weight (VLBW) neonates in the first few hours of life. VLBW neonates comprise the majority of high-risk deliveries. Even when these neonates are vigorous and crying, pink and well-perfused, they are at risk. Decisions made in the first hours of life can result in a smooth transition to extrauterine life or can hasten and worsen maladaptation.Provide best-case outcomes for VLBW neonates with Golden Hours: Care of the Very Low Birth Weight Neonate, a practical clinical guide for the NICU.
